The United States is home to more international migrants than any other country, receiving 20% of the world’s “people on the move.” Today, 13.8% of U.S. residents are foreign-born, with 1 in 25 people having never heard about Jesus. Many East and Southeast Asians arrive in the U.S. from countries where the gospel isn’t easily accessible.
Through our new Global Neighbors Ministries, we collaborate with churches and networks to see multiplying followers of Jesus, among every East and Southeast Asian people group across the U.S., who are joining God’s plan to reach all nations.
On this episode of the podcast, Global Neighbors Facilitator Angie Long joins President and Co-National Directors of OMF (U.S.) James and Lisa Dougherty to talk about OMF's heart for this exciting opportunity to share the good news of Jesus.
